Vuex Api Middleware, Uses the popular HTTP client axios for requests.


Vuex Api Middleware, type: Object | Function The root state object for the Vuex store. Vuex Pinia is now the new default The official state management library for Vue has changed to Pinia. What is this good for If you want to connect a REST API Build fast, production-ready web apps with Vue. Works with websanova/vue-auth . File-based routing, auto-imports, and server-side rendering — all configured out of the box. Meaning that Vuex is different in that it knows it’s in a Vue app. I For plugins, asyncData, fetch, nuxtServerInit and Middleware, you can access it from context. For instance, you don't need to care about serialization Store Constructor Options state type: Object | Function The root state object for the Vuex store. In this guide, we'll Understand how state management works, and when to use tools like Pinia and Vuex for your Vue applications. 2 Is it possible to pass data from Vuex Store to serverMiddleware in Nuxt. js import Fetching data from external APIs and managing the state with Vuex are essential skills for building dynamic Vue. properties All properties are reactive. Latest version: 2. In this tutorial, I will show you how to build a Vue. If you use axios with Vuex ORM, you may find handling Examples Check out the Composition API example to see example applications utilizing Vuex and Vue's Composition API. 15. A Helper utility to simplify the usage of REST APIs with Vuex 2. You need to request the data from the api (with an action) and set the state (via a mutation). But Once you start using Vuex to manage the shared data of your Vue application, it becomes less clear on where or how to call your back-end API. More Practice: – Vue. A helper utility to simplify the usage of REST APIs with Vuex. I've currently got it setup to use vue-resource with two files like this: /src/store/api. You need to request If you want to connect a REST API with Vuex you'll find that there are a few repetitive steps. $auth. If you want to connect a REST API with Vuex you'll find that there are a few repetitive steps. Store Constructor Options state type: Object | Function The root state object for the Vuex store. # state 1. Uses the popular HTTP client axios for requests. js 2 CRUD Application to consume REST APIs, display and modify data using Vue 2, Vue Router and Axios. Examples Check out the Composition API example to see example applications utilizing Vuex and Vue's Composition API. By integrating Vuex Vuex ORM Axios plugin adds smooth integration between API requests and Vuex ORM data persistence through the awesome axios. js ? What is a middleware pipeline? A middleware pipeline is a stack of different middlewares ran in parallel with each other. Middleware lets you define custom functions that can be run before rendering either a page or a group of pages (layout). js? In nuxt. js applications provides a structured and maintainable way to manage shared state. config Then how do I access the data in api/index. js applications. Pinia has almost the exact same or enhanced API as Vuex 5, described in Vuex 5 RFC. This is useful 每一个 Vuex 应用的核心就是 store(仓库)。“store”基本上就是一个容器,它包含着你的应用中大部分的 状态 (state)。Vuex 和单纯的全局对象有以下两点不同: Vuex 的状态存储是响应式的。当 Vue 组件 The middleware directory contains your application middleware. If you want to connect a REST API with Vuex you'll find that there are a few Uses the popular HTTP client axios for requests. This allows it to better integrate with Vue, offering a more intuitive API and improved development experience. Based on axios. Details If you pass a function that returns an object, the returned object is used as the root state. . 0, last published: 9 months ago. Details If you pass a function that returns an object, the returne Uses the popular HTTP client axios for requests. Works with websanova/vue-auth. Mastering Vuex — Zero to Hero The official documentation of Vuex defines it as a state management pattern + library for Vue. js JWT Vuex. You could . It serves as a centralized store for all the components in an application, with rules ensuring that the state can only be mutated in a Using Vuex for state management in Vue. Using our hypothetical case Learn how to protect routes in Vue applications using middleware pipelines, including creating components, setting up routes and middlewares, and implementing the middleware logic for Vuex. Store 构造器选项 state 类型: Object | Function Vuex store 实例的根 state 对象。 详细介绍 如果你传入返回一个对象的函数,其返回的对象会被用作根 state。这在你想要重用 state 对象,尤其是对 Vuex is a state management pattern + library for Vue. This Using Pinia with Nuxt is easier since Nuxt takes care of a lot of things when it comes to server side rendering. Start using vuex-rest-api in your project by running `npm i vuex-rest I have a Vue Webpack app with Vuex (I am new to both, coming in from the Ember world). ztexwte, 9uivtef5, 2hrygkj, 2akzvmnx, ufo, q4, pn, l71, yr, uhu, tzslvzs, gtc, afsulr6y, gyt7, bmqi, j5ptqr, 8qhw, wlj, q1fl, nt2m, ypyr, l6osipv, d14cx, fpc, imf, budkdz, ok9rzj, 0ottjnt, yzur, b3evt,